Understanding Lottery Commissions: How Much Do Sellers Earn from Jackpot Wins?

When discussing the earnings of lottery sellers from jackpot wins, it's important to understand that these commissions can vary significantly depending on the jurisdiction and the specific rules of the lottery organization. Generally, lottery sellers receive a commission for each ticket sold, and this is often a fixed percentage of the ticket price.

However, when it comes to jackpot wins, the situation is a bit different. Some lotteries offer a bonus or a flat rate to the seller whose customer wins a large jackpot. This bonus is not a percentage of the winnings but rather a set amount determined by the lottery's policies. For example, a lottery may award a retailer a bonus of $10,000 or $25,000 for selling a winning ticket for a major jackpot.

The rationale behind this practice is to incentivize retailers to sell more tickets and to reward them for their role in facilitating a significant win. It's also a way for the lottery to generate publicity; a local store celebrating a big win can attract more customers and create buzz around the lottery.

In terms of technology, modern lottery systems are highly sophisticated, using advanced software and hardware to track sales, manage drawings, and ensure security. Retailers are equipped with point-of-sale terminals that are connected to the central lottery system, allowing for real-time tracking of ticket sales and immediate validation of winning tickets. These technological advancements have made it easier for lotteries to administer commissions and bonuses efficiently and transparently.

It's worth noting that while the bonus for selling a winning jackpot ticket can be substantial, it is typically a small fraction compared to the actual prize won by the player. Nevertheless, for many retailers, especially small businesses, these bonuses can represent a significant financial boost.

How does technology influence the commission rates for lottery vendors?

Technology can significantly reduce operational costs for lottery vendors by automating sales and tracking, which can lead to lower commission rates. Additionally, online platforms may offer higher commissions due to reduced physical infrastructure needs. However, the influence of technology on commission rates also depends on the regulatory framework and the competitive landscape within the lottery industry.

What technological systems are in place to ensure fair compensation for lottery sellers?

Commission-based systems are in place to ensure fair compensation for lottery sellers, where they receive a fixed percentage of the sales or profits. Additionally, electronic point-of-sale (POS) systems track transactions accurately, ensuring sellers are credited for each sale. Auditing software is also used to monitor and verify transactions, preventing discrepancies and fraud. These technological systems work together to maintain transparency and fairness in compensating lottery sellers.

How has the adoption of online lottery platforms affected the earnings of traditional lottery vendors?

The adoption of online lottery platforms has generally led to a decline in earnings for traditional lottery vendors. As consumers shift towards the convenience of purchasing tickets online, physical vendors experience a reduction in foot traffic and sales. Additionally, online platforms often offer a wider variety of games and services, making them more attractive to users and further diverting revenue from traditional outlets.
